Banquette Beauty....


I recently added a banquette bench to one side of my new dining table. I'm loving the varied seating options and decor opportunities that it provides.






I had always had my mind set on this BARREL LEG EXTENSION TABLE FROM OLD LUMBER (through Harvest), but I knew I wanted to contrast its rough textures with softer seating.



I've acheived this with my white linen, slipcovered Parsons chairs and soft gray, velvetty banquette. To break up all the gray, and add yet another layer of texture, I've draped a simple, off-white throw ($10 from ikea - score!) down the center of the banquette and added throw pillows made from french linens and vintage flour sacks, (pillows also available through Harvest). I envision changing the throw and accent pillows through the seasons to give the dining room a fresh new look.
